The Chronicle on whether CJ and Pitre will play on TNF

The fact that Ryans would rule out Stroud and Pitre so early indicates that both players continue to exhibit symptoms from the injury and haven't progressed enough to practice. Neither practiced Friday and won't make the trip to Nashville.

That could complicate their status to play beyond Sunday’s game against the Titans. The Texans have a short week after Tennessee with a Thursday Night Football game against the Buffalo Bills at home.

Before returning, players in the concussion protocol must first go through a non-contact practice and then a contact practice the next day without exhibiting symptoms in either.

Stroud and Pitre technically have three more opportunities to get those two practices in before they can be cleared.

The Texans could leave a trainer behind and simulate a practice on Sunday. They could also practice on Monday at the team's walk-through, then go through a full contact practice on Tuesday to be cleared.

We'll know for sure when Monday's injury report is released.
